IRVINE, Calif. – In a game in which the No. 4 Cal women's water polo team led for 17 of the game's first 24 minutes, the Bears ultimately dropped a heartbreaking 12-11 decision to No. 3 UCLA in the Third Place Game of the Barbara Kalbus Invitational at UC Irvine.

The Bears (12-3) went toe to toe with one of the top teams in the nation, and led 9-7 with 3:21 left in the third period. The game was still tied at 11-11 with 3:51 to play but the Bruins' Rachel Fattal scored on a penalty shot with 17 seconds left to decide it.

Junior All-American Dora Antal scored three goals for the Bears while senior Genevieve Weed and junior Kindred Paul added a pair of scores apiece.

Cal built the lead up to 6-3 with 3:51 left in the second quarter before UCLA answered with three in a row to tie it at 6-6 early in the third. Consecutive goals by Antal and Paul pushed the Bears' advantage back to two.

After the Bruins went out in front 10-9, Antal scored her third goal of the game to tie it with 6:50 remaining. UCLA went out in front again only to see Weed knot it back up at the 3:51 mark of the fourth.

Senior goalie Madeline Trabucco made five saves for the Bears, whose three losses this season have come twice to No. 1 Stanford and the No. 3 Bruins.

The Bears have a bye next week and will return to the pool March 11 against No. 19 Harvard at Spieker Aquatics Complex. The match will be televised by the Pac-12 Networks.
